Symptoms of Knee Pain / Knee Instability

Knee pain can be quite debilitating, as it is one of the most used and complex joints of the human body. The stability of the knee is due to four ligaments, muscles and the actual joint structure. During the course of a normal day, the knee goes through a whole range of motions, from sitting, walking, twisting etc.

The knee also supports our weight in conjunction to the feet. Because of the abuse we put our knees through there can be damage to the muscle, cartilage or the joint itself. Some of the pain can be alleviated with the use of anti-inflammatory ointments or tablets, more severe cases need medical attention for a more effective treatment while some patients have even had their knee or knees replaced.

These can vary from person to person and can range from nagging to acute pain, or discomfort while doing normal daily chores.

 

  • Inflammation of the joint

  • Tenderness around the area

  • Instability [knee gives way for no reason]

  • Locking

  • A feeling of grinding

  • Popping

  • Stiffness

  • Injury to the knee

  • Can manifest it-self with body aches and back pain
